Hottest Female Superheroes: Top Tier Heroines Ranked

The hottest female superheroes redefine power by blending iconic abilities with deeply resonant character arcs. From mythic origins to modern blockbusters, these figures shape how audiences see strength, leadership, and resilience across film, comics, and games.

This structured overview highlights standout heroines, their signature powers, cultural milestones, and evolving representation. Each entry captures visual identity, narrative role, and impact on fans and the industry as a whole.

Defining Heroine Power in Modern Media

Today’s hottest female superheroes dominate headlines by merging striking visuals with emotionally driven storytelling. Studios invest heavily in these characters, knowing that layered motivations and cultural relevance translate into strong audience engagement and long‑term franchise value.

Power sets range from mythic abilities like divine strength to tech‑based mastery and empathetic leadership. This variety invites broader identification, showing that heroism can be fierce, cerebral, compassionate, or quietly revolutionary depending on the heroine and her world.

Evolution of Female Representation in Superhero Stories

Female superheroes have moved from supporting motifs to central architects of universe‑spanning narratives. Early portrayals often emphasized romance or sidekick roles, but modern arcs highlight strategic command, moral complexity, and solo journeys that inspire merchandising, fandom, and critical discourse alike.

Milestones such as leading comic runs, groundbreaking animated series, and global cinematic events demonstrate how these characters have become symbols of possibility. Audiences now expect nuanced backstories, formidable stakes, and representation that reflects real diversity in culture, identity, and aspiration.

Visual Design and Iconic Imagery

Distinctive costumes, color palettes, and signature weapons make the hottest female superheroes instantly recognizable. Designers balance practicality with symbolism, using armor, capes, and emblems to communicate values like justice, rebellion, or hope without sacrificing mobility for dynamic action sequences.

From Wonder Woman’s armor and lasso to Storm’s sleek uniform and cosmic lightning, each visual language reinforces the character’s narrative role. Strong silhouettes, emblematic logos, and carefully chosen textures ensure these heroines remain memorable across posters, toys, and digital media.
